Renderer process modules in Electron API

Renderer process modules include: contextBridge, ipcRenderer, and webFrame.

jQuery/RequireJS/Meteor/AngularJS incompatibility with Electron

Due to Node.js integration in Electron, extra symbols are inserted into the DOM like module, exports, and require. This causes problems for libraries that want to insert symbols with the same names. To solve this, turn off node integration by setting nodeIntegration: false in BrowserWindow webPreferences. Alternatively, rename the conflicting symbols before including other libraries by reassigning them to different names like window.nodeRequire = require and deleting window.require, window.exports, and window.module.

Rename Node.js symbols before including libraries

To use libraries like jQuery that conflict with Node.js symbols, rename the symbols before including the libraries: <head><script>window.nodeRequire = require;delete window.require;delete window.exports;delete window.module;</script><script type="text/javascript" src="jquery.js"></script></head>

Renderer process definition

The renderer process is a browser window in an Electron app. Unlike the main process, there can be multiple renderer processes and each is run in a separate process. They can also be hidden.

Webview tag for embedding guest content

Webview tags are used to embed guest content (such as external web pages) in an Electron app. They are similar to iframes but differ in that each webview runs in a separate process. A webview doesn't have the same permissions as the web page and all interactions between the app and embedded content are asynchronous. This keeps the app safe from the embedded content.

contextBridge exposeInMainWorld method signature

contextBridge.exposeInMainWorld(apiKey, api) exposes an API to the renderer from an isolated preload script. The apiKey parameter is a string that specifies the key to inject the API onto window with; the API will be accessible on window[apiKey]. The api parameter is the API object being exposed.

contextBridge exposeInIsolatedWorld method signature

contextBridge.exposeInIsolatedWorld(worldId, apiKey, api) exposes an API to a specific isolated world. The worldId is an integer; 0 is the default world, 999 is the world used by Electron's contextIsolation feature. Using 999 would expose the object for preload context. Recommendation is to use 1000+ when creating isolated worlds. The apiKey is a string for the window property key. The api is the API object being exposed.

contextBridge executeInMainWorld experimental method

contextBridge.executeInMainWorld(executionScript) is an experimental method that executes a function in the main world. The executionScript parameter is an object with func (a JavaScript function to execute; this function will be serialized so bound parameters and execution context will be lost) and optional args (an array of arguments to pass to the function; these arguments will be copied between worlds according to supported types). Returns a copy of the resulting value from executing the function in the main world.

ipcRenderer module is an EventEmitter

The ipcRenderer module is an EventEmitter that provides methods to send synchronous and asynchronous messages from the renderer process to the main process, and to receive replies from the main process.

ipcRenderer.on method signature

ipcRenderer.on(channel, listener) listens to channel; when a new message arrives, listener is called with listener(event, args...). Channel is a string, and listener is a Function that receives IpcRendererEvent and any number of additional arguments.

ipcRenderer.off method signature

ipcRenderer.off(channel, listener) removes the specified listener from the listener array for the specified channel. Channel is a string, and listener is a Function that receives IpcRendererEvent and any number of additional arguments.

ipcRenderer.once method signature

ipcRenderer.once(channel, listener) adds a one-time listener function for the event. The listener is invoked only the next time a message is sent to channel, after which it is removed. Channel is a string, and listener is a Function that receives IpcRendererEvent and any number of additional arguments.

ipcRenderer.addListener is alias for ipcRenderer.on

ipcRenderer.addListener(channel, listener) is an alias for ipcRenderer.on(channel, listener).

ipcRenderer.removeListener is alias for ipcRenderer.off

ipcRenderer.removeListener(channel, listener) is an alias for ipcRenderer.off(channel, listener).

ipcRenderer.removeAllListeners method signature

ipcRenderer.removeAllListeners([channel]) removes all listeners from the specified channel. If no channel is specified, removes all listeners from all channels. The channel parameter is optional and of type string.

ipcRenderer.sendToHost method signature

ipcRenderer.sendToHost(channel, ...args) sends a message to the webview element in the host page instead of the main process. Like ipcRenderer.send, it takes channel as a string and any number of additional arguments.

process.isMainFrame property

process.isMainFrame is a readonly boolean that is true when the current renderer context is the main renderer frame. To get the ID of the current frame, use webFrame.routingId.

process.contextId property

process.contextId is an optional readonly string representing a globally unique ID of the current JavaScript context. Each frame has its own JavaScript context. When contextIsolation is enabled, the isolated world also has a separate JavaScript context. This property is only available in the renderer process.

clipboard API access from renderer process deprecated

Using the clipboard API directly in the renderer process is deprecated as of electron/electron pull request 48877.
